Restaurant Overview and Charm: A Slice of Paradise on Kouri Island
Sushi Tunaya offers a unique dining experience on Kouri Island, surrounded by the breathtaking blues of the ocean. The journey to this restaurant takes you across the stunning Kouri Bridge, setting the tone for a memorable meal. Originally established in Aichi, the restaurant's move to Okinawa was inspired by the owner's roots, making it a local gem. With spectacular views of the bridge, the restaurant boasts an exceptional location that adds to its charm.

Okinawa - The Tropical Paradise of Japan
Okinawa, known for its stunning beaches and rich cultural heritage, is a popular tourist destination that captivates visitors with its unique blend of traditions and natural beauty. The archipelago offers a plethora of attractions that highlight its historical significance and serene landscapes.
- Shurijo Castle: Once the royal palace of the Ryukyu Kingdom, Shurijo Castle is a UNESCO World Heritage site that showcases traditional Okinawan architecture and offers captivating views of the city.
- Okinawa Churaumi Aquarium: This renowned aquarium features various marine life from the waters of Okinawa, including majestic whale sharks, providing an unforgettable family-friendly experience.
- Cape Manzamo: Famous for its stunning cliff views and the iconic elephant trunk-shaped rock, Cape Manzamo is a picturesque spot perfect for photography and watching the sunset over the East China Sea.
